Well Mr Notepad.
My job is writing web pages and script coding. No one uses note pad to hard code its just too basic and has no s/r feature line numbers indent or lookup table. For hand coding Edit Plus takes some beating and for WYSWYG dreamweaver is the top with Adobe Golive 2nd. DW4 now includes a decent code view and you can suppress the auto edit functions quite well. Making web pages for porn is best done with a WYSWYG proggy. You can play around with your layout then tidy up when it looks right. D/L DW4 demo and then look around for the ***** Thats providing its just for home use http://bbs.gofuckyourself.com/board/smile.gif Always check your pages with all browsers before loading. Its a good idea to get a copy of Opera 3.61 because if they render ok in this (mainly table sizing) they will render in most stuff. if there are any other Mac users in the bunch, BBEdit rocks for that platform. I've heard it's very similar to HomeSite, but I have never tried HomeSite. I just started using a PC at the dayjob, but I don't make the pages here so I don't need an editor.
For WYSIWYG editors, I have Dreamweaver and GoLive both, and I actually vastly prefer GoLive, though they both do really well at not fucking up code. GoLive has a toggle back and forth between visual and source, which uses BBEdit. I love that. I can't remember if Dreamweaver does too, because it's been too long since I've used it. |
